Whitney Blake Company designs, manufactures and distributes electrical retractile cords and cable assemblies which are primarily used by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s) as a component in the manufacture of a variety of commercial and military communications, electronic data processing, medical electronic, durable goods and other equipment.

As the first commercial supplier of retractile cords (Koiled Kords™), the Company has developed a strong marketing position. Although the technology and quality associated with its products have become more standard (non-patented) over the years, management believes that its level of engineering design and support is unique in the industry.

• Whitney Blake is one of the few manufacturers with expertise in rubber and neoprene coiled cord manufacturing. Although more expensive, rubber and neoprene have good flexibility in a wide range of temperatures and harsh environments, requires a lower force to extend and has good “memory.” As a result it is often used in top-of-the-line or professional grade OEM products.

• The Company is unique in its capability to insulate tinsel with rubber and has a proprietary method of processing rubber coiled cords. Similarly, with its proprietary rubber insulating, jacketing and molding compounds it is believed to be the only qualified vendor producing military rubber communications cords which meet current specifications

• Whitney Blake tailors its products to the customer's specific needs. The Company produces retractile cords and cable assemblies for use in a variety of applications by responding to specific customer orders rather than maintaining a broad finished-good inventory. In this regard, less than 15% of Whitney Blake's business consists of stock/inventory sales.

• The Company’s strategy is to use its engineering design expertise to become the vendor of choice as new OEM products are developed. Whitney Blake is actively involved in the OEM product development cycle often spending 6 to 18 months producing samples and prototypes before a customer order is placed. Over the years, the Company has accumulated a large library of cord designs and performance data associated with various designs and materials.
